The Emergence of Digitization in Air Cargo
Traditional air freight operations have long relied on manual processes, outdated paperwork, and fragmented communication channels. These inefficiencies often lead to delays, increased costs, and reduced visibility for stakeholders across the supply chain. Recognizing these challenges, industry leaders have increasingly turned to comprehensive digital platforms that serve as centralized hubs for all aspects of cargo management.

Key Features Driving Transformation
| Feature | Description | Impact on Industry |
|---|---|---|
| Real-time Tracking & Visibility | Provides instant updates on cargo location, status, and estimated delivery times | Enhances operational transparency and improves customer trust |
| Automated Documentation & Compliance | Digitalizes paperwork such as airway bills and customs declarations | Reduces errors and accelerates clearance processes |
| Dynamic Pricing & Capacity Management | Utilizes data analytics to optimize pricing strategies and capacity allocation | Increases profitability and resource utilization |
| Integrated Payment & Settlement Systems | Facilitates secure, seamless financial transactions within the platform | Streamlines billing and reduces cash flow delays |

Case Study: Enhanced Supply Chain Resilience
Amid supply chain crises like the COVID-19 pandemic and geopolitical disruptions, digital platforms have proven essential. They enable proactive rerouting, instant communication, and dynamic resource management. For instance, companies leveraging integrated cargo management systems experienced a 15% increase in on-time deliveries during 2022, demonstrating resilience and agility in turbulent times.
